This book details the modern workers compensation system and its operation within the statutory, contractual and juridical world in which the coverage exists.
Legal and contractual concepts are concretely demonstrated using simple and accurate explanations.
Concepts explained in this book include: what constitutes a compensable injury, who are general contractors responsible for insuring, second injury funds, the borrowed servant doctrine, employers liability coverage, when additional states must be added to the policy, audits, and a detailed description of how to interpret experience modification factors.
The appendices combine to provide a synopsis of specific work comp laws and injury reporting requirements for every state.
